Brad Stevens claimed the Celtics-Lakers game will be a great opportunity for everyone to savor the experience of one of the most historic rivalries in sports.

(via masslive.com):

“You always have to remind yourself what you at 8 years old would have thought. What you at 15 years old would have thought,” Stevens said before Saturday’s matchup.

When you’re concerned about your role or how many minutes you might play or when you’re going in, don’t forget about that 15-year-old that would have died to be at the end of the bench.

“This is a special opportunity, a special rivalry. Obviously, the opportunity to compete against the very best is always a great challenge,” Stevens noted.

The Celtics will face the Lakers for the first time this season. Boston is on a 6-4 record during its last 10 games trying to find balance as a team after going through leagues health and safety protocols the last couple of weeks.

On the other hand, the Lakers are on a two-game losing streak after starting the season with a 10-0 record on the road.
